Output 39fca12ca42ffee2623ec3a7e7c8eb87230c4182d79e35ce12db64a2d7b014e6:1

value
2652464
script pubkey
OP_0 OP_PUSHBYTES_20 dd368333c9bfa9d916967c1e2e963e4751dc3707
address
ltc1qm5mgxv7fh75aj95k0s0za937gagacdc8p6cffq
transaction
39fca12ca42ffee2623ec3a7e7c8eb87230c4182d79e35ce12db64a2d7b014e6
spent
true